Data collection of primary central nervous system tumors; National Program of Cancer Registries training materials, 2004

    This book is based on a training presentation prepared in part by the North American Association of Central Cancer Registries (NAACCR) and supported by contract 200-2001-00044 from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C). We thank Shannon Vann, CTR, of the NAACCR, and all of the reviewers who assisted in the preparation of that presentation. Gayle Greer Clutter, RT, CTR, of the CDC's Division of Cancer Prevention and Control oversaw the preparation of this book. Valerie R. Johnson, ABJ, provided editorial assistance; and Reda J. Wilson, MPH, RHIT, CTR, provided valuable feedback on the final drafts. Special technical assistance was provided by Roger E. McLendon, MD, Neuropathologist, Duke University Medical Center. This book was designed by Palladian Partners, Inc., under contract 200-2003-F-01496 for the National Center for Chronic Disease Prevention and Health Promotion, CDC.

    Appendices -- Appendix A: Collaborative stage codes -- Appendix B: Benign Brain Tumor Cancer Registries Amendment Act -- Appendix C: Accessioning primary intracranial and central nervous system tumors : general reporting rules -- Appendix D: ICD-0-3 Primary brain and CNS site/histology listing
